Why Sealcoating is Essential for Chino Pavement
The climate in Chino and the broader Inland Empire presents unique challenges for asphalt. Intense, year-round UV exposure and heat accelerate a process called oxidation, which causes the asphalt binder to dry out, become brittle, and turn a faded grey color 1 2. This brittle pavement is far more susceptible to cracking. While Chino lacks harsh winter freezes, winter rains can penetrate these small cracks, leading to water intrusion, base erosion, and eventually, costly potholes 3. A high-quality sealcoat acts as a sunscreen and a waterproof barrier, blocking UV rays and preventing water from seeping into the pavement structure.
Beyond weather, usage patterns dictate the wear on your lot. High-traffic areas like retail centers, restaurants, and fast-food drive-thrus experience concentrated stress from power steering turns, constant braking, and oil or fluid leaks 4. These lots require more frequent protective maintenance. In contrast, lots for offices, apartments, or warehouses with lower, more consistent traffic can often follow a less frequent schedule 5. Sealcoating is the most cost-effective way to manage this wear and tear, preventing minor issues from escalating into major repairs.
Determining the Right Schedule for Your Property
A one-size-fits-all schedule doesn't work for asphalt protection. The frequency of sealcoating depends on several factors: the age of your asphalt, the amount and type of traffic it bears, and the quality of the previous applications.
- New Asphalt: If you have a newly paved lot, it's crucial to allow the asphalt to fully cure, releasing oils and gases. The initial sealcoat should typically be applied within 6 to 12 months after installation.
- Routine Maintenance: For most commercial properties in Chino with average traffic, a sealcoating application every 2 to 3 years is the standard recommendation to maintain optimal protection.
- High-Traffic Lots: Properties like shopping plazas or popular dining establishments may need their pavement sealed more frequently-every 12 to 24 months-to combat the accelerated wear from constant vehicle movement and potential fluid spills.
The Critical Role of Professional Preparation
A successful, long-lasting sealcoat is 90% preparation. Applying sealant over a dirty, oily, or cracked surface is a waste of resources, as it will quickly fail to adhere and peel away. Professional contractors follow a meticulous preparation process to ensure the coating bonds properly 6.
- Thorough Cleaning: The entire surface must be free of dust, dirt, leaves, and debris. This is achieved through mechanical sweeping, blowing, and often power washing.
- Degreasing: Oil and grease stains are not just unsightly; they prevent the sealant from bonding. Professionals use specific degreasing agents to treat these areas, ensuring a clean surface for adhesion 7 8.
- Crack Filling: Any cracks, typically up to 1/2 inch wide, must be filled before sealcoating. Contractors use hot-applied rubberized sealant to fill these cracks, preventing water from entering the base material and causing further damage 9.
- Vegetation Removal: Weeds and grass growing along curbs and cracks are removed to ensure a clean edge and proper sealant application.
The Best Time of Year for Sealcoating in Chino
Timing your pavement sealing project correctly is vital for the material to cure properly and achieve maximum durability. The ideal conditions are dry and warm.
- Optimal Window: The best time for asphalt sealing in Chino is from late spring through early fall, specifically from June to October 10. During these months, temperatures are consistently warm, humidity is lower, and rain is unlikely, providing perfect conditions for the sealant to dry and cure fully.
- Avoiding Moisture: Sealcoating should never be applied if rain is forecast within 24-48 hours, or if the ground is damp. Moisture trapped under or in the coating will cause it to fail.
- Pre-Winter Strategy: Completing a sealcoating project in the early fall is an excellent strategy to prepare your pavement for winter rains, sealing any micro-cracks that formed over the summer.

What to Expect: The Sealcoating Process and Curing
Once the site is prepared, professional crews will apply the sealant, usually a coal tar or asphalt-based emulsion, using spray systems and squeegees for even coverage. A quality job often involves two coats for enhanced durability, especially in high-wear areas 11. After application, the most critical phase begins: curing.
The fresh sealcoat needs time to dry. While it may be dry to the touch in a few hours, it requires a full 24 to 48 hours to cure sufficiently before vehicles can drive on it 12 13. During this time, the lot must be completely closed to all traffic. Driving on uncured sealcoat will cause tracking, imprinting, and permanent damage, ruining the new surface. Proper planning for this closure period is essential.
Post-Sealcoating: The Importance of Re-Striping
A fresh sealcoat will cover all existing pavement markings. Therefore, re-striping your parking lot is an immediate and necessary follow-up step once the sealant has fully cured 14. This is not just for aesthetics; clear, compliant striping is crucial for safety, traffic flow, and ADA accessibility. For most lots, re-striping is done on an 18- to 24-month cycle, but high-traffic lots may need fresh paint every 12-18 months to maintain visibility and compliance 15.
Understanding Costs for Sealcoating in Chino
The cost of commercial sealcoating is typically quoted per square foot and can vary based on the lot's size, condition, and preparation needs.
- Small Lots (< 10,000 sq ft): Smaller projects often have a higher cost per square foot, generally ranging from $0.25 to $0.40 or more, which usually includes thorough cleaning and the application of two coats 16 17.
- Large Lots (> 30,000 sq ft): Larger properties benefit from economies of scale, leading to a lower cost per square foot, often in the range of $0.15 to $0.25 18 19.
- Additional Costs: It's important to note that essential preparation work, such as crack filling, is usually priced separately based on the linear footage of cracks that need treatment 20. Always ensure your quote clearly details the costs for preparation, the sealcoat application, and any ancillary services like re-striping.
